Overcoming Emotional Trauma: Stories of Resilience

justice

Many individuals who have experienced dog bite scarring face not only physical wounds but also emotional trauma. The impact can be profound, leaving them with lasting fears, anxiety, and flashbacks. However, stories of resilience abound, as people find ways to overcome their scars both visible and invisible.

Overcoming dog bite scarring often involves a combination of therapy, support groups, and self-care practices. Some have found solace in seeking professional help from therapists or counselors who specialize in trauma. Others turn to sharing their experiences with like-minded individuals in support groups, fostering a sense of community and understanding. In their journeys, these survivors learn to reframe their narratives, turning challenges into opportunities for growth. This process empowers them to reclaim their lives, rebuild their confidence, and live fully despite the scars they bear.

The Physical Journey: Scar Healing and Management

justice

The physical journey of healing from dog bite scarring is a multifaceted process. Initially, after a dog bite, proper wound care becomes paramount to prevent infection and promote healthy scar formation. This includes keeping the area clean, applying appropriate dressings, and monitoring for signs of inflammation or infection. As scars begin to form, specialized treatments like topical creams, compression therapy, or silicone gels can aid in reducing their appearance and texture.

Over time, as collagen production increases, scars may remain visible, but with dedicated management, they can be minimized. Options range from surgical revision to non-invasive procedures like dermabrasion or laser resurfacing. It’s crucial to consult with a dermatologist or plastic surgeon who understands the nuances of scar revision, especially considering the distinct healing properties of different skin types and wound severity levels. This personalized approach ensures that individuals affected by dog bite scarring can work towards achieving smoother, less noticeable scars, moving beyond the physical reminders of their experience toward a more comfortable and confident future.
